Representatives from 175 countries will meet in Geneva, Switzerland, from 5th-14th August to negotiate a legally binding UN treaty to end plastic pollution. Non-governmental organisations, academics and industry lobbyists will also be present, hoping to influence what could be the world’s first global agreement on plastics. This summit, called ‘INC-5.2’, follows an unsuccessful meeting in... Auto Recycling World · 1 Aug 2025 Industry news Viridor to close Rochester plastics recycling site Viridor has announced that it will be closing and decommissioning its mechanical recycling centre in Rochester, Kent. The closure follows “a detailed strategic review” of the site which launched in November 2024, alongside a wider strategic review of Viridor’s UK mechanical recycling operations due to “wider market challenges”.
